Why Give a Mother-of-the-Bride Morning Gift?

Weddings move fast. The ceremony arrives; the reception fills with toasts and dancing; your mother becomes a gracious guest in your day. A morning gift interrupts that schedule and says: right now, before anything else, we pause together.

This tradition has roots in both practicality and sentiment. Historically, families exchanged gifts on the morning of a wedding—not as obligation, but as a moment to breathe. Modern couples revive it because it works. Your mother has invested months in planning, emotional energy in your happiness, and often her own money and time. A morning gift acknowledges that without fanfare or expense.

The best morning gifts are personal: they reference a shared memory, inside joke, date, or role. They're also tangible—something she'll hold, wear, or display afterward. A spoken thank-you matters. A printed or engraved gift matters more.

Gift Types That Work for Mothers of the Bride

Personalized Keepsake Boxes Small, elegant boxes engraved with her name, the wedding date, or a short message hold jewelry, mementos, or a handwritten note. After the wedding, she uses it to store her mother-of-the-bride jewelry or keep the day's memories safe. Explore keepsake boxes.

Engraved or Monogrammed Jewelry A bracelet, necklace, or ring with her initials, the wedding date, or a single word (Proud. Grateful. Mom.) worn today and always. Jewelry feels like both a gift and a promise.

Custom Star Map or Date Print A framed print showing the night sky on her wedding night, or the exact moment she became your mother. It's sentimental without being saccharine. Browse personalized prints.

Handwritten Card or Vow If you're not ready to speak, write. A handwritten letter, sealed and personal, says things you might stumble over aloud. Pair it with any small keepsake. See vow books and writing collections.

Photo Keepsake or Album A small printed album of photos from your engagement, childhood, or family moments—something she can flip through and keep nearby.

Timing & Logistics: When to Present It

Morning gifts typically arrive 30 minutes to 2 hours before the ceremony. This gives you time for a genuine moment without feeling rushed. If you're getting ready separately, arrange delivery to her hotel or home; if together, hand it to her in person.
